In her studio photoshoots, Jayalalithaa experimented with bold patterns, psychedelic prints, large sunglasses, and oversized hoops. Even when wearing sarees, she revolutionized the look by opting for sleeveless blouses, experimental necklines, and modern draping styles that highlighted her statuesque poise.

As the 80s progressed, Sridevi became the poster child for glamorous transformation. Her photoshoots featured metallic fabrics, sequined gowns, voluminous permed hair, and bold monochromatic chiffon sarees paired with sleeveless pearl-string blouses. She seamlessly blended innocent charm with high-octane editorial glamour.
